Course Content

• Tree Nursery Establishment and Site Selection
• Seed Collection, Processing, and Storage (Seed Pathology)
• Propagation Techniques: Seedling Production and Grafting
• Nursery Management: Irrigation, Fertilization, and Pest/Disease Control
• Tree Nursery Inventory and Record Keeping
• Containerized Tree Production and Handling
• Bare-Root Tree Production and Handling
• Quality Control in Tree Nurseries (Plant Health)

Career path

Career Role (Tree Nursery Management) Description
Tree Nursery Manager Oversees all aspects of tree nursery operations, including propagation, planting, and sales. High-level management and strategic planning crucial.
Horticulturalist (Tree Nursery Specialist) Focuses on the cultivation and propagation of trees; expert knowledge of plant health and soil management. Strong practical skills needed.
Tree Nursery Technician Assists in all stages of tree production; performs tasks such as planting, pruning, and pest control. Foundation-level role in tree nursery practices.
Sales and Marketing (Tree Nursery) Responsible for promoting and selling nursery stock to clients; builds relationships with landscape contractors, garden centers, and other clients. Excellent communication skills essential.
